The defamation complaint of Jonathann Daval, sentenced to 25 years of imprisonment for the murder of his wife Alexia, against the latter's mother and sister, was dismissed, the Vesoul prosecutor's office announced on Tuesday.

The procedure opened for defamation was “dismissed for lack of prior complaint”, Jonathann Daval not wishing “to cause any further harm, with a new complaint, to the Fouillot family”, specifies prosecutor Arnaud Grécourt in a press release.

On February 19, Daval's lawyers filed a complaint with the Vesoul public prosecutor for "public defamation", targeting comments made by Isabelle Fouillot and Stéphanie Gay, Alexia's mother and sister, in the fourth episode. of the television series entitled “Alexia notre fille” and broadcast by the Canal + channel.

“Upon receipt of this complaint, an investigation was ordered.

It appears from the hearing of Mr. Jonathann Daval, carried out by the gendarmerie services, that he has not viewed the documentary" and that he "does not wish to file a complaint against Isabelle Fouillot and Stéphanie Gay", specifies the prosecutor.

The law of July 29, 1881 on freedom of the press – which provides for and punishes defamation – “makes the complaint of the defamed person an essential precondition for prosecution,” notes Arnaud Grécourt.

However, “given the desire of Mr. Jonathann Daval not to file a complaint for these acts of defamation”, expressed “on several occasions”, “no criminal proceedings can be brought”, according to the magistrate.

Accusations of poisoning

According to the complaint initially filed, Isabelle Fouillot and Stéphanie Gay presented in the series “an unprecedented version of the affair, unequivocally accusing Jonathann Daval of having deliberately poisoned his wife to cause the miscarriage” and “to drive her

crazy

and cause discomfort.

However, these elements on a possible poisoning of Alexia Daval had been dismissed during the trial before the Haute-Saône Assize Court.

The complaint denounced “a desire to present the Daval affair to the public from an inaccurate angle” with the aim of “harming” Jonathann Daval.

The latter will also appear on April 10 before the Besançon criminal court for slanderous denunciation against his in-laws, in particular for having accused his brother-in-law of being the author of the murder of Alexia, before admitting his lie.

Jonathann Daval strangled his 29-year-old wife in 2017 at their home in Gray-la-Ville (Haute-Saône), before burning her body in a wood.

For three months, Jonathann Daval had shown the face of a grieving widower in the media, before being confused.
